CHICAGO — A Lakeview man has been charged with reckless homicide from a fatal motorcycle crash on Lake Shore Drive, according to police.

Charles Lyons, 20, of the 800 block of West George Street, was charged with a reckless homicide with a motor vehicle and aggravated reckless driving and received various citations, according to a Chicago Police news release.

Lyons was driving a motorcycle on Monday night when he didn't stop at a red light at Balbo and Lake Shore Drive, according to police. He hit two people, killing one and injuring the other.

A 25-year-old woman, a German national, was taken to Northwestern Hospital in critical condition. She later died from her injuries. She has not yet been identified as authorities seek to notify her family in Germany.

A 40-year-old man was taken to Stroger Hospital in serious condition and was treated. Lyons was also taken to Northwestern for injuries he received during the crash.
